Sign In — Free (10 views/day)WOODSIDE VILLAGE IV INC, founded in 2001, is a small nonprofit in the Housing & Shelter sector that reported $242K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 21%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$39K, a strong 16% operating margin.
PROVIDE AFFORDABLE HOUSING FOR THE ELDERLY AND DISABLED
